BMS Costs: A Comprehensive Guide

Understanding your business management system’s complete cost might be challenging. Starting expenses generally encompass platform fees, setup services, and training expenses. Past these aspects, periodic support costs, like technical support and anticipated upgrades, must be considered. Moreover, unexpected fees – such as information transfer or tailoring – must be thoroughly assessed to prevent budget surprises.

Understanding Business Operational System Pricing Models

Navigating the world of corporate management solutions can be difficult, especially when it comes to costs. Many providers offer a range of packages, often using confusing descriptions. You might encounter options like individual subscriptions, feature-driven costs, or even progressive structures. Usually, user-centric costs are straightforward to grasp, but unexpected costs, such as onboarding costs or support charges, can quickly add up. It's important to closely examine the components of a provider's value structure and analyze your specific requirements before making a choice.
